Key job responsibilities The Construction Cost Engineer will be responsible for: - Engaging and managing third party Quantity Surveyors.
- Validating construction cost estimates at various stages of design.
- Working seamlessly with multi-disciplinary teams, both internal and external.
- Communicating cost control goals to all stakeholders effectively.
- Identify Value Engineering opportunities in the design and quantify the savings.
- Updating repository for historical data.
- Defining and tracking cost performance metrics and leading monthly cost reporting.
- Analyzing and providing timely feedback of vendor proposals using AWS benchmark data.
- Creating accurate bid leveling documents.
- Validating the final award amount and scope based on contract documents.
- Implementing, maintaining and executing all cost control, change management, progress and performance reporting.
- Validating construction change cost impacts.
- Ensuring vendor invoices are accurate and timely.
- Supporting the construction team with project close-out and final payments.
